The Transformation Via Autonomous Cars

Self-governing transportation technology is poised to change the area of enhancing the pace, effectiveness, and financial stability of relocating products. Driverless vehicles can function constantly without breaks, resulting in notable declines in shipment durations. Conversely, drones give quick delivery options that are specifically useful in city settings for covering brief ranges.

Benefits of Autonomous Vehicles in Logistics

1. By adopting independent cars, companies can dramatically minimize their logistics expenditures by decreasing labor-related expenses. With a decreased demand for human drivers, services can assign fewer sources towards staff member payment, benefits, and training programs. Furthermore, the undisturbed operation of lorries all the time enables firms to maximize their asset performance and get one of the most out of their fleet.
2. Improved Productivity: Self-driving automobiles have the ability to successfully prepare and adjust courses on-the-go to prevent traffic jams and minimize fuel. This causes reduced functional costs and much less damage to the environment. Drones use a fast and reliable shipment service by flying over roadway congestion.
3. Boosted Safety and security: Human error is a leading source of mishaps in logistics. Autonomous automobiles, equipped with sophisticated sensors and AI, can substantially decrease the threat of mishaps. They can keep constant rates, adhere purely to traffic legislations, and respond to dangers more quickly than human motorists.
4. Scalability: The scalability of logistics procedures is greatly improved with independent cars. Firms can easily broaden their fleets without the limitations imposed by personnels. This is particularly helpful during peak periods when demand rises.

Obstacles Facing Autonomous Cars in Logistics

1. Regulatory Obstacles: The regulatory landscape for independent vehicles is still progressing. Various countries and regions have differing laws and policies, developing a complex setting for companies operating worldwide. Achieving compliance and obtaining approval for self-governing procedures can be time-consuming and expensive.
2. Security Worries: While independent vehicles guarantee improved safety, they are not infallible. Technical malfunctions, cyberattacks, and unpredicted obstacles position considerable threats. Guaranteeing the dependability and protection of these systems is paramount, needing strenuous screening and robust cybersecurity procedures.
3. Technology restrictions: Although self-governing vehicles utilize advanced innovation, it is not perfect. Negative climate can influence sensing units, and navigating through intricate city settings can be difficult. Continuous improvements and imaginative remedies are critical to overcome these obstacles.
4. Extensive fostering of self-driving cars and trucks depends upon getting the depend on of both the public and sector specialists. To conquer this obstacle, it's important to honestly attend to and ease concerns surrounding job displacement, safety, and system dependability through clear interaction, education and learning, and demos that display the benefits and reliability of independent modern technology.
